
Human leukocyte antigen - Wikipedia
The human leukocyte antigen (HLA) system is a complex of genes on chromosome 6 in humans that encode cell-surface proteins responsible for regulation of the immune system. [1] The HLA system is also known as the human version of the major histocompatibility complex (MHC) found in many animals.

Human Leukocyte Antigen (HLA) System - The Merck Manuals
The human leukocyte antigen (HLA) system (the major histocompatibility complex [MHC] in humans) is an important part of the immune system and is controlled by genes located on chromosome 6. It encodes cell surface molecules specialized to present antigenic peptides to the T-cell receptor (TCR) on T cells.
人类白细胞抗原(HLA基因复合体所编码的产物)_百度百科
人类白细胞抗原(human leukocyte antigen, HLA)是由HLA基因复合体所编码的产物,定位于第6染色体短臂上。HLA系人类组织相容性复合体(MHC)的表达产物,是构成移植排斥反应的重要抗原物质。HLA的研究最初是在器官移植研究推动下开展起来的,故此,HLA又称移植抗原。
